Parallel Lines Cut by a Transversal
What is special about the alternate interior angles when the two lines cut by a transversal are parallel?
What is special about the same side interior angles when the two lines cut by a transversal are parallel?
What is special about the alternate exterior angles when the two lines cut by a transversal are parallel?
They are congruent
They are supplementary (add up to 180˚)
They are congruent
